Here is the pending dates and content for the upcoming GGI fall schedule.

Guncamp at the volcano liar Sept 3-6

Advanced Pistol Operations and Techniques
Oxford, NC Oct 1-3
Defensive Shotgun Intro with Randy Lee
Oxford, NC Oct 4
Carbine one day
Oxford, NC Oct 5

APS
Paducah, KY
Oct 23-25 (dates are not yet firm)

Advanced Pistol Operations and Techniques
Orlando, FL
November 2009 (dates are not yet firm)

NC and Guncamp enrollment threads should go up pretty soon, and I am expecting KY to go up within the next 10 days if the dates work out with the range.

Not at all. I apologize on behalf of our friends for inadvertently omitting his name from our adjunct instructor roster, along with Wayne Dobbs and a few others we work with from time to time for that matter.

Indeed, Cooper, Jones and I have been working together towards a 1911 Operators Course for at least a year now. He has access to some excellent facilities in the JAX area to offer, and we will cook up a plan to host some classes with him ASAP.

I had the distinctly pleasant honor of working a class with Wayne Dobbs 2 years ago, the last time we were in Texas. Since then we've been slammed. In my distracted condition, I have been negligent in getting another set of dates arranged with Wayne and aim to rectify my inadvertant lapse presently. He's fantastic. If you can get into a class with Wayne anywhere, do it.

Similarly, now that things have settled down around GGI's famous Secret Volcano Base I want to plan a couple dates to teach with Angi Kelley for the 2010 season. My good buddy Lisa Farrell and I met Angi when we all worked for the NSSF as media education instructors and she's been a great asset and good friend whom I have missed working with lately.

Lisa is another outstanding talent with whom I've shot and worked many times. She will hopefully be on hand to work the line with us at our ambitious San Diego class coming up in October.

As for my friend Sigfreund's inquiry as to who our instructors are, I'm pleased to have an opportunity to brag on them in a general way.

I will say that I'm blessed to be able to count on each of these outstanding talents to support our program while offering the highest quality experience to our students.

GGI isn't the Bruce Gray show, nor should it be. Only an arrogant fool (and I wish never to be counted in that fraternity) would put his ego above the interests of his clients by failing to employ, much less fully recognize and develop, his betters.

So while I am arguably accepted as being OK at teaching what I know best, I am proud to collaborate with, and defer to, each of them. Each stands at the head of his or her respective fields of expertise, and each brings powerful instructional skills to the line.

That's not vapid hype. Ask our students.
